Optimizing your hydronic heating system performance is seamless with the Taco i100C3R-1 iSeries 3-way mixing valve. This advanced unit is engineered to provide precise water temperature management, ensuring your indoor comfort remains consistent regardless of fluctuating external conditions.
By modulating the internal valve position, the i100C3R-1 effectively blends supply and return water to maintain your desired setpoint. The integrated outdoor reset technology automatically adjusts the system's output based on real-time ambient temperatures, which significantly reduces fuel consumption and prevents energy waste common in fixed-temperature systems.
